Innovative and accessible, this book provides a roadmap for designing school environments that address the needs of English learners (ELs). Offering a wealth of resources to support school leaders working with multilingual students, Auslander and Yip explain how a systems thinking approach enables the development of stronger school-wide multi-tiered systems of support and can lead to meaningful,... Biography

Lisa Auslander is the principal investigator and senior project director for Bridges to Academic Success, a project of the Graduate Center, CUNY. She is a former teacher, coach, and administrator in New York City schools.

Joanna Yip is a curriculum specialist for multilingual learners and an instructional coach.
